1. Sports and Outdoors gifts for Dad

Thank your active, outdoorsy and nature-loving Fathers for helping you learn the importance of fresh air, exercise and play with these. They’re some of the best sports and outdoors gifts for dad.

Allbirds’ stylish, naturally sweat-wicking wool sneakers ($95) are soft and itch-free on the inside and durable and water-resistant on the outside. So Dad is always ready for an adventure. Speaking of adventures, the BioLite Camp Stove with Coffee Press ($199.95) will elevate any camping trip that you willingly or unwillingly get dragged on. Help him ditch his worn backpack with this lightweight, water-resistant nylon backpack from Burberry ($1,290) that is modeled after functional military kit. Add in a pair of Olympus 10×42 PRO Binoculars ($519), which provide 10X magnification. They’re perfect if he’s an avid bird watcher. Or just wants a better view at stadium sporting events.

5. Foodie Gifts for Dad

Bringing home the bacon. Or cooking the bacon. We could always count on Dad to indulge our love of good food and drinks. The best foodie gifts for Dad will make everyone in the household satiated and happy.

Everyone has a favorite pizza place but there’s something really fun about making your own. This outdoor Ooni Pro Pizza Oven ($599.95) is the world’s most versatile outdoor oven. It’s capable of burning wood, charcoal, pellets or gas and can bake up to a 16” pizza. Another of the best foodie gifts for Dad is a DIY kitchen tool for meat-lovers. We vote for this Weston Electric Grinder ($174.95). It’s heavy duty, grinding 3 pounds of meat per minute and comes with a funnel for stuffing fresh sausages. For the vegetarian fathers out there, try a monthly subscription to Purple Carrot ($287/month for 3 meals a week), a gourmet plant-based meal prep kit with yummy options like Portobello Panang Curry and Beet Tacos.
